Body
Origins and Family
Born in Philadelphia[2], Richard Gere… he was born on August 31, 1949[3]. His father was Homer George Gere[10]. His mother was Doris Anna Tiffany[11]. English was his native language[14].
Education
Educated at University of Massachusetts Amherst[16], a university[28], in United States[29], founded in 1863[30], headquartered in Amherst[31] and Cicero – North Syracuse High School[17], a high school[32], in United States[33], founded in 1967[34]. Richard Gere studied under Wynn Handman[35].
Career and Affiliations
Recorded occupations include actor[4], film actor[5], film producer[6], film director[7], human rights defender[8], and television actor[15].
Recognition
Awards received include Donostia Award[18], a film award[36], in Spain[37], founded in 1986[38]; Marian Anderson Award[19], an award[39], in United States[40], founded in 1998[41]; Geuzenpenning[20], a medallion[42], in Netherlands[43], founded in 1987[44]; Light of Truth Award[21], an award[45]; James Parks Morton Interfaith Award[22], an award[46]; and Theatre World Award[23], a theatre award[47], in United States[48], founded in 1945[49].
Personal Life
Among Richard Gere's spouses was Alejandra Silva[12]. His religion is recorded as Tibetan Buddhism[24].
